(Australia) A midday break for a meal and rest taken by drovers and their livestock.
Looking at that brownie cake reminded me of a most unusual happening when we had come back to the mill for dinner camp in the middle of the day.

(Australia) The location of the temporary camp created for dinner camp.
I remember one day on dinner camp, we was all relaxing as the horses fed around us, when all of a sudden the station horses took off.
